S. Rondot is a scholar working on Materials Chemistry, Surfaces, Coatings and Films and Electrical and Electronic Engineering. According to data from OpenAlex, S. Rondot has authored 41 papers receiving a total of 563 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Materials Chemistry, 18 papers in Surfaces, Coatings and Films and 17 papers in Electrical and Electronic Engineering. Recurrent topics in S. Rondot’s work include Electron and X-Ray Spectroscopy Techniques (18 papers), High voltage insulation and dielectric phenomena (15 papers) and Polymer Nanocomposites and Properties (7 papers). S. Rondot is often cited by papers focused on Electron and X-Ray Spectroscopy Techniques (18 papers), High voltage insulation and dielectric phenomena (15 papers) and Polymer Nanocomposites and Properties (7 papers). S. Rondot collaborates with scholars based in France, Algeria and Tunisia. S. Rondot's co-authors include O. Jbara, S. Fakhfakh, A. Hadjadj, Françoise Berzin, Yongshang Lu, Lan Tighzert, Z. Fakhfakh, Mohamed Belhaj, J. Cazaux and A. Mekhaldi and has published in prestigious journals such as Science, Journal of Applied Physics and The Journal of Physical Chemistry B.
